Transaction dc314bc92ce65d539e8a324f0a48b78c27aa86e665d6095ff99ce7f5139c922a
3 Input
2 Outputs
- dc314bc92ce65d539e8a324f0a48b78c27aa86e665d6095ff99ce7f5139c922a:0
- dc314bc92ce65d539e8a324f0a48b78c27aa86e665d6095ff99ce7f5139c922a:1
value 7811563
address 1G5ERSgDgmtjWQYh7HMRg4s8PPeG4AWCAo
value 1904534
address 18HcsrpAGAvXbaaxUpBXtc7ZAYjjh56ZPg